WebInclude the balancing test in Minnesota Statutes, section 13.03, subdivision 6. Example language: Pursuant to Minn. R. Civ. P. 45.03 (c), the Court shall quash a subpoena if it requires “disclosure of protected matter.”. As the subpoenaed data are classified as private under Minn. Stat. § 13.43, the data are “protected matter.”.
